About This Item

London: Spring Books, 1971. Hardcover. g. 4to. 296 pp. Goldenrod buckram binding w/dj. Head and tail of spine lightly bumped. Minor chipping to tail of spine of dj. Profusely illustrated with visual materials ranging from trade cards, advertisement and menus to contemporary engravings and photographs. In overall good+ condition.
